Finding the magnitude of a vector
WebThe magnitude of a vector is its size. It can be calculated from the square root of the total of the squares of of the individual vector components. There must be a direction as well, or its not a vector quantity. Let magnitude = r, and let direction = Θ. Find the x component with r·cosΘ, and the y component with r·sinΘ.
